§ 49-7-4. Exemption of records relating to hunting, fishing and trapping license applications and holders of such licenses from Mississippi Public Records Act.

Universal Citation: MS Code § 49-7-4 (2018)

The records of the Department of Wildlife, Fisheries and Parks relating to applications for and sales of any resident or nonresident licenses issued under this chapter, and all records related to holders of such licenses, are exempt from the provisions of the Mississippi Public Records Act of 1983, in accordance with Section 25-61-11, and shall be released only upon order of a court having proper jurisdiction over a petition for release of the record or records. However, upon request, the records specified in this section shall be available to all law enforcement agencies.
